I have created intervention groups called WIN or what I need for all students in grades 6-12. Students were either placed in a math or literacy group based on their specific needs. They will receive instruction at their level to help them grow in order to close the opportunity gap. In addition to the academic side of learning, I would like to give students the opportunity 1 day per week to interact with their peers by playing an educational game.
I would like students to interact with their peers face-to-face rather than relying on screen time to learn. I have requested these games to fit both needs. Students will have the choice of games to play in their literacy and math WIN classes. Teachers will be able to share games throughout the week so that all students have access to this fun way to learn and retain information.
